1
0
Commit Graph

2746 Commits

Author SHA1 Message Date
madmaxoft
293051eca8 Merge remote-tracking branch 'origin/fixes'. 2013-11-13 11:08:51 +01:00
Tiger Wang
347162a82f Bundled fixes [SEE DESC]
* BoundingBox now returns FACE_NONE
+ Arrows can be picked up
* Arrows dug up resume physics simulations
* Added sound effects for bows, lava to stone, and arrows
* Fixed SoundParticleEffect on <1.7 protocols
2013-11-12 21:43:20 +00:00
madmaxoft
11c5ad1170 cWindow: Fixed item dupe glitch with painting (#278) 2013-11-12 13:15:09 +01:00
madmaxoft
8fa8107e45 Fixed dblclicking in crafting slot area.
Fixes #229.
2013-11-11 21:33:14 +01:00
madmaxoft
9287349cc2 APIDump: Documented Vector3d. 2013-11-11 16:02:10 +01:00
Mattes D
c15daee808 Merge pull request #328 from mborland/master
VC2013 Build Files
2013-11-11 01:59:09 -08:00
mborland
3710d423ac Merge remote-tracking branch 'upstream/master' 2013-11-10 18:33:58 -05:00
Tiger Wang
f713780db3 Bundled fixes [SEE DESC]
* Fixed compiler warning in Monster.cpp
* Future proofed particle effects
* Improved pickups, made less jittery
2013-11-10 22:20:25 +00:00
madmaxoft
09e4f041dd Fixed cRoot::FindAndDoWithPlayer().
Now /kick and /ban work.
2013-11-10 22:58:39 +01:00
madmaxoft
480ff3789b Protocol 1.7: Fixed crashes and d/c with bad packets.
Fixes #332.
2013-11-10 22:58:39 +01:00
madmaxoft
f0aab7c580 ProtoProxy: Added dblquotes. 2013-11-10 22:58:39 +01:00
Mattes D
3a692d53e8 Merge pull request #330 from tonibm19/patch-1
Added sheep dyeing
2013-11-10 13:04:27 -08:00
STRWarrior
165f68b8d9 Removed #include "../Root.h" since it isn't needed. 2013-11-10 21:59:38 +01:00
madmaxoft
dadae874f2 Small code-style fixes. 2013-11-10 21:55:32 +01:00
Tiger Wang
71abbb2f56 Bundled fixes [SEE DESC]
* Fixed pickups spawning in an incorrect position from a JukeBox
* Pickups make a popping sound in Prtcl1.7
* Arrows make a *what sort of sound does an arrow make anyway‽* when
hitting a block, and a popping sound when fired
* Mobs again have metadata
* Fixed Prtcl1.7 not using valid JSON to kick a client
* Minecarts and arrows again have metadata
2013-11-10 20:48:12 +00:00
madmaxoft
dde491ee0e Merge branch 'master' into WolfUpdate 2013-11-10 21:42:56 +01:00
STRWarrior
2ccf9b2b32 Renamed variables in cWolf. 2013-11-10 21:24:36 +01:00
STRWarrior
e62858ec3d Using DoWithPlayer instead of FindAndDoWithPlayer for callbacks.
You are able to dye the collar.
2013-11-10 20:12:30 +01:00
madmaxoft
bd664e0a90 Implemented inventory dblclick.
Implements #229.
2013-11-10 18:42:46 +01:00
madmaxoft
fe07012952 Added cItem::GetMaxStackSize() 2013-11-10 18:41:26 +01:00
STRWarrior
4f11cd2f8a The owner object isn't stored anymore. Instead we use the name of the player.
This means only players can now have a wolf, but it fixes the bug where when you log out the wolf isn't your wolf anymore.
2013-11-10 18:03:19 +01:00
tonibm19
4af5868322 Fixes (SEE DESC)
Entity metadata is broadcasted.
If player is in survival, his equipped item is removed.
If you have green dye, and sheep is green, your equipped item won't be removed.
2013-11-10 17:05:19 +01:00
tonibm19
da5bd81836 STR_Warrior was right.
Simplified code.
2013-11-10 16:48:22 +01:00
tonibm19
e2b4745bbf Fixed compilation 2013-11-10 16:43:47 +01:00
tonibm19
9da4011a7f You can no longer color with wood 2013-11-10 16:42:38 +01:00
tonibm19
e919496025 Added sheep dyeing 2013-11-10 16:03:00 +01:00
STRWarrior
0980567912 Using cMonster::Tick instead of super::cMonster::Tick 2013-11-10 15:51:32 +01:00
STRWarrior
38f6fff3fb Wolves can now be owned by an entity.
They only sit when right clicked by their owner.
They beg if the closest player has meat or bones in his hand.
They follow their owner.
They teleport to their owner if they are more then 30 blocks away.
They don't attack players if they are not angry anymore.
They don't move if they are sitting.
2013-11-10 15:16:43 +01:00
madmaxoft
fb3a175b28 Protocol 1.7: Attempt at fixing SoundParticleEffect packet. 2013-11-10 14:19:02 +01:00
madmaxoft
3fd7124435 Fixed Player animation packet.
Fixes #329.
2013-11-10 13:40:38 +01:00
mborland
5dfce5568e VC2013
3rd times a charm?
2013-11-10 02:33:34 -05:00
madmaxoft
0762893ee1 APIDump: Documented cServer:IsHardCore() 2013-11-09 21:18:03 +01:00
madmaxoft
b6ca98f380 Removed cStringMap.
It wasn't used for anything anymore.
2013-11-09 19:54:52 +01:00
madmaxoft
73cd2216a7 Fixed cTracer's tolua markup.
Cleaned up unneeded member variables.
2013-11-09 19:49:36 +01:00
madmaxoft
148f723632 APIDump: Documented TakeDamageInfo. 2013-11-09 19:25:03 +01:00
madmaxoft
d74b0dbd5b APIDump: Documented the relevant tolua functions. 2013-11-09 19:16:44 +01:00
madmaxoft
157bd150fd APIDump: Added logging to see what takes so long. 2013-11-09 18:55:24 +01:00
madmaxoft
359fb9af39 Prepared the VC2013 folder. 2013-11-09 14:31:58 +01:00
mborland
d2c530ec33 Removed redundant qualifier
Removes compiler warning C4114
2013-11-09 14:26:54 +01:00
mborland
54fa4db793 Hard Reset 2013-11-09 14:26:46 +01:00
madmaxoft
9e38c00b5e Updated Core and ProtectionAreas. 2013-11-09 14:22:59 +01:00
madmaxoft
404034d230 Fixed sprinting in 1.7 protocol.
Fixes #324
2013-11-08 22:40:31 +01:00
madmaxoft
efbc4a9b78 Declaring 1.7.2 compatibility. 2013-11-08 22:09:39 +01:00
madmaxoft
24428a9768 MobSpawner: Added skeleton and wolf conditions.
This fixes the flood of warnings in the server console in Debug mode.
2013-11-08 22:06:08 +01:00
madmaxoft
07fa8313b1 cProtocol::SendWindowOpen() signature changed.
This implements #313.
2013-11-08 21:32:14 +01:00
madmaxoft
b24bdff308 Fixed code style. 2013-11-08 21:06:31 +01:00
madmaxoft
4707784929 Protocol 1.7: Fixed using entities.
The mouse buttons were swapped.
2013-11-08 21:03:51 +01:00
madmaxoft
64412c1fe3 Protocol 1.7: Copied Mob Metadata code from 1.2.5. 2013-11-08 20:56:19 +01:00
Mattes D
d33112b6b1 Merge pull request #321 from mc-server/1.7pickupsfix
Fix for entity spawning in general
2013-11-08 08:41:46 -08:00
Mattes D
71461dccbc Merge pull request #322 from tonibm19/master
Now chicken drop eggs
2013-11-08 08:33:14 -08:00